Beulah Frances MATHES

Galena Cemetery


Funeral services for Beulah Frances Mathes will be held Monday, May 15, 2023, at 2 p.m. at the Alva Church of God, with burial following at Galena Cemetery under the direction of Marshall Funeral Home.

Beulah Frances (Rhodes) Mathes was born April 12, 1926 to D.E. and Cordelia (Sayres) Rhodes and went on to her heavenly home May 8, 2023, at the age of 97 years and 25 days.

Beulah was the 10th of 11 children, and attended a country school in the Greensburg area until eighth grade, and then graduated high school from Waynoka, Oklahoma, with the class of 1945. Four days later she was united in marriage to Charles William Mathes on May 20, 1945, at Charles' parents home. They farmed in the Galena area until 1953 when they moved to Alva, Oklahoma. They moved to their present home September of 1960 where they raised chickens and bees and always had a large garden, selling produce, eggs, and honey at the local farmers market. Beulah was a long time member of the Assembly of God Church in Alva. She also began attending the senior citizen center in 1986 serving as a member of the board for several years. She was a beloved wife, mother, sister, grandma, great grandma, and friend.

Beulah was preceded in death by her husband Charles of 53 years; parents D.E. and Cordelia; one son, Marion David Mathes; two daughters, Louise Ann and Judy Marie; one daughter-in-law, Grace Mathes, and all 10 of her siblings.

She is survived by her son John William Mathes of Carmen, grandson Thomas Frank Mathes of Carmen, grandson Michael Dwayne Mathes and wife Amy of Mustang, grandson Daniel Eugene Mathes and wife Amy of Mustang, six great-grandchildren, Abbigail Clayton of Waynoka; Cheyenne, Dakota, Kiowa, Austin, Alicia all of Mustang.

Memorial contributions may be made through the funeral home to the Senior Citizen's Center or the Alva Church of God.
